How It Works

Three steps to a healthy, pain-free tooth

CBCT 3D imaging machine used for root canal diagnosis at International Dental Joliet

Step 1

3D imaging & diagnosis

Our in-house CBCT scanner gives us a precise 3D view of your tooth anatomy, root canals, and surrounding bone, so treatment is accurate from the first appointment.

Dentist performing root canal treatment at International Dental of Joliet

Step 2

Remove infection & disinfect

We gently remove the infected tissue, thoroughly clean and disinfect each root canal, and seal it with biocompatible material to prevent future problems.

Patient receiving post-root canal dental crown consultation at International Dental Joliet

Step 3

Restore strength with a crown

A custom dental crown is placed over the treated tooth to restore its strength, function, and natural appearance, built to last for years.

FAQ

Common questions about root canal treatment

Will a root canal hurt?

No. Root canal therapy relieves pain. It doesn’t cause it. We use advanced anesthesia so you feel nothing during the procedure. Most patients are surprised at how comfortable the experience is.

How long does root canal treatment take?

Most appointments take 60–90 minutes. Front teeth are typically faster than molars. Our advanced rotary instrumentation helps us work efficiently without compromising precision.

How much does a root canal cost?

Cost depends on tooth location and complexity. Front teeth average $800–$1,200, molars $1,200–$1,800. Most PPO insurance covers 80% of endodontic treatment. Call us for a personalized estimate.

What are the alternatives to root canal therapy?

The main alternative is extraction, but that leads to bone loss and shifting teeth. A dental implant can replace an extracted tooth, but preserving your natural tooth is always the preferred outcome.

How long does a treated tooth last?

With a crown and proper oral hygiene, a root canal-treated tooth can last a lifetime. Schedule regular exams at International Dental to keep it protected. Learn about our exams and cleanings.

Do I need a crown after root canal therapy?

Yes. A crown is essential. Treated teeth become more brittle over time. A custom dental crown protects the tooth from fracture and re-infection, completing your endodontic treatment.

Can a tooth get re-infected after treatment?

Re-infection is rare. Success rates exceed 95%. It can occur if a crown fails or new decay exposes the root filling. If this happens, retreatment is possible and effective.

Can I drive home after my appointment?

Yes, unless you choose nitrous oxide or IV sedation, in which case you’ll need a driver. Most patients feel completely normal within 1–2 hours of completing the procedure.
